Charity Challenge is the world's leading fundraising challenge operator, best known for organising the Comic Relief celebrity Kilimanjaro Climb. Each year the company arranges over 100 expeditions, having run more international challenges and raised funds for more charities than any other company worldwide.
Charity Challenge has helped thousands of people raise more than £30m for over 1,200 different charities, making it a trusted choice for those wishing to combine adventure with a worthy cause.
The company's portfolio spans more than 30 countries and offers a wide range of experiences to suit different interests and abilities.
Whether a charity is looking for a challenge to raise funds for its cause, an adventurer wants a way to lose weight and get fit, or a corporate organisation hopes to engage its employees, Charity Challenge offers dozens of adventurous itineraries to excite and inspire.
